1. THE GOSPEL REACHED THE FIRST CENTURY WORLD IN SIX STAGES

The human author of the Book of Act is Dr. Luke and the correct title is “Acts of Apostolic men Acts 1:1-3; Luke 1:3; Acts 6:7. The name of the recipient, Theophilus, means, a lover of God. The Book of Acts shows us how the Church spread from (i) Jerusalem, to (ii) Palestine, to (iii) Antioch, to (iv) Asia Minor to (v) Europe, and finally to (iv) Rome, the headquarters of the world. So that the world was reached in six stages Acts 9:31; Acts 12:24; Acts. 16:5; Acts 28:31.
